**Changelog — Reportforge 4.2.1**

Renamed `REPORTFORGE_STABLE_ORDER` to `REPORTFORGE_SORT_STABLE`. Old name is dead as of this release; no alias, no warning. With the flag on, multi-column sorts in the report builder now use a stable merge, so rows with equal keys keep insertion order instead of shuffling between runs. On-call: if a tenant reports flapping row order, set the new flag to `1` and restart the builder pods. The builder also needs its datastore credential present in `.env` after the flag; append this line:

sealed setting: RELAY_SECRET13=bca49b02a6971

**Mgmt Meeting Minutes — Retiring the Brightline Range**

Quick recap for sales leads at Fenholt Supplies: we agreed to retire the Brightline fixture range by year-end. Remaining stock moves to clearance pricing next month, and accounts on standing orders get migrated to the Lumetta range. Trade-in incentives were approved in principle. The confidential note on next steps sits just below.

board note of bajof-bajeg: The pricing group signed off on a budget of $13.4 million for Project Sildor. The renewal with Lamixek Holdings closes at $48.9 million a year, 49 percent above the last contract.

**Q: Why does `strex` flag half my PR as "untranslated"?**

Heads up for reviewers: the Marzipan extraction script (`strex`) chokes on template literals with nested ternaries and marks them untranslated. It's a parser quirk, not the author's fault — don't block the PR. If strex locks its cache mid-run, reset it with the recovery passphrase below.

unlock words, fahop-yageg: ralwyn-kelath

# Approvals: Flagwright Rollout Framework

All changes to Flagwright core require approval before merge. This covers rollout-percentage logic, kill-switch paths, and targeting rules. Reviewers: do not approve solo. Check that every new flag has an owner, an expiry date, and a documented rollback. Staged rollouts must start below 5%. Experimental targeting predicates need an extra design note linked in the PR. No exceptions for hotfixes; use the incident override process instead. Final sign-off authority rests with the person named below.

approver of yajef-fajef = Oliwyn Silion Kasok Kasox